Common questions about Symphony Communication Services UK Limited

Is Symphony Communication Services UK Limited a licensed UK visa sponsor?
Yes. Symphony Communication Services UK Limited in London holds a UK sponsor licence and appears on the Home Office register of licensed sponsors, where it has been listed since 2018. That means it is permitted to sponsor eligible workers from overseas, though a licence is permission to sponsor rather than a guarantee that any particular vacancy is open to sponsorship.
What visa routes can Symphony Communication Services UK Limited sponsor?
Symphony Communication Services UK Limited is licensed for Global Business Mobility: Senior or Specialist Worker and Skilled Worker. Its licence is recorded on the register as "Worker (A rating)" — the rating reflects the Home Office's confidence in the sponsor's compliance record.
